Dataset: Endometrial hyperplasia and carcinoma

Using mouse models of endometrial tumorigenesis based on two of the most common molecular alterations found in primary human UEC we sought to characterize the transition from CAH to carcinoma to identify clinically useful biomarkers. In order to identify novel candidate genes associated with invasion, global gene expression profiles were compared from uteri with extensive CAH and carcinoma. Keywords: Gene expression profiling RNA was extracted from uterine segments with either CAH or invasive carcinoma from Pten+/-;Mlh1-/- , Pten+/-;Mlh1+/+ and Wild type female mice. The RNA was hybridized to Affymetrix mouse 430A chip in order to determine changes in global gene expression patterns
